When Lionel Messi was released from his contract on Sunday night there was only one real team in the race for his signature being Paris St Germain. Manchester City were out of the running after signing Grealish (100 million) and Chelsea signing Lukaku (97.5 Million) the only other clubs who could be open luring Messi.
The token price on Sunday night was just over $30 and at lunch time today was over $61 Dollars. This is the first time I have seen what signing a player does for a token and is interesting to take note as a future reference.
Most tokens do something with good news like a new exchange listing or a key partnership but this is totally different in many ways. The Barcelona token hasn't done anything and thinking that Messi left them surely the price would react but it is still stuck on $25.
Fans must react differently to normal investors as they are buying the token to back their team and to open up extra rewards such as ticket pricing and special promotions only available to token holders.

Arsenal launch their token on the 12th and will be following how the price changes after launch. I expect other Premiership teams to follow suit soon afterwards so having the knowledge by studying how this plays out is important as a quick in and out trade.
This is interesting to note for traders who want to make a buck or two as other sporting teams introduce their fan tokens over the coming months and years. Paying attention to the transfer market can actually make you a return depending on who is being signed and if it is seen as a big move or not.
The only other time of making on these tokens seems to be at launch as they sky rocket so fast as the fans want to get their hands on them. At launch this token went from $29 to $44 and then dropped to $23 as the crypto market retreated.
What interests me is how the fans react to the news and is important to store in the memory banks as this will be replicated across all fan tokens in the future.
